FRIDAY CREEK

Just 20 mins out of Coffs hidden in amongst pristine rain forest, lies a creek that cuts its way through the Coffs hinterland. Tucked up in the far end of the Orara Valley lies what us locals call Friday Creek. 

Heading just 7km west of coffs, turn left onto mount Browne road and continue onto South Island Loop Road. Passing through the stunning Orara Valley till the road becomes North Island loop road. Here on the left is Dingo Creek Fire Trail. Now while a 2wd car can get the first pool on the left, you'll need a 4wd to get to what we call the magic pools, or the rock slide. 

Go along Dingo Creek until the 2nd track on the right, then follow Carmody’s Trail for around 4km until you see the Rock Slide down on your left. Park and enjoy. Great place to swim or even plank.

One section in particular has large rock pools, deep enough to either jump off a side cliff ( well a 15 foot bank !!! )... or slide down a smooth rock waterfall. The great thing about this area is that you just see a minimal amount of people up there, and when you do it is only the locals that really know where to go. Explore the side trails at the lush rainforest and pristine creeks, if your lucky you'll find some old bridges and other little waterfalls.
